How to Use DogBreedMatcher Effectively
To get the most out of DogBreedMatcher, itΓΒ’ΓΒΓΒs important to approach the quiz with honesty and thoughtfulness. Here are some practical tips to help you use the tool effectively:
1. Be Honest About Your Lifestyle
Answer the questions truthfully. If youΓΒ’ΓΒΓΒre a busy professional who travels frequently, this will influence the types of breeds that are most suitable for you. Breeds that are more independent or have lower exercise needs may be better suited to your lifestyle.
2. Consider Your Home Environment
Are you living in a small apartment or a large house with a yard? The space you have available will affect the breed that is best for you. Some breeds are more suited to indoor living, while others require more space to roam and play.
3. Think About Your Activity Level
Dog breeds vary widely in terms of energy levels. If you're an active person who enjoys hiking, running, or playing fetch, you may be a better match for a high-energy breed like a Border Collie or a Labrador Retriever. If you lead a more sedentary lifestyle, a calmer breed like a Basset Hound or a Pug may be a better fit.
What to Do After Finding Your Match
Once youΓΒ’ΓΒΓΒve identified potential breeds that match your lifestyle, the next step is to research each breed further. Look into their temperament, health concerns, grooming needs, and training requirements. You may also want to speak with breeders, rescue organizations, or current owners of the breeds you're interested in to get a better understanding of what to expect.
If you're planning to adopt, consider reaching out to local shelters or rescue groups that specialize in the breed you're interested in. Many rescue organizations have detailed profiles on each dog, including their personality, behavior, and any special needs they may have.
Tips for a Successful Dog Ownership Experience
Whether you've found your perfect match through DogBreedMatcher or another method, here are some tips to ensure a successful and happy experience with your new pet:
- Start with Basic Training: Early training helps establish good behavior and strengthens the bond between you and your dog.
- Provide Proper Nutrition and Exercise: A balanced diet and regular exercise are essential for your dogΓΒ’ΓΒΓΒs health and happiness.
- Schedule Regular Vet Checkups: Preventative care is crucial for catching health issues early.
- Socialize Your Dog: Expose your dog to new people, animals, and environments to help them develop confidence and good social skills.
- Be Patient and Consistent: Building a strong relationship with your dog takes time, patience, and consistency.
